What Is Programmatic SEO?
Programmatic SEO is the process of using data and automation to generate large numbers of web pages targeting long-tail keywords.
Instead of writing every page manually, businesses use templates and structured data to scale content efficiently.

How Programmatic SEO Works
Step 1: Keyword Research at Scale
Identify patterns in search queries, such as:
- Service + location
- Product + feature
- Industry + solution
Step 2: Create Page Templates
Design reusable layouts that include:
- Dynamic headings
- Structured content sections
- SEO-optimized metadata
Step 3: Build a Data Source
Use spreadsheets or databases to populate pages with:
- Locations
- Services
- Product variations
Step 4: Generate Pages
Use CMS platforms like:
- WordPress
- Webflow
…to automatically create and publish pages.

Risks & Common Mistakes
Programmatic SEO can backfire if done poorly:
- Thin or low-quality content
- Duplicate pages
- Poor user experience
- Over-automation without value
Search engines like Google prioritize quality, not just quantity.
Best Practices for 2026
- Add unique value to each page
- Combine automation with human editing
- Focus on user intent
- Optimize internal linking
- Monitor performance and refine pages
